Digiloogika II konspekt
Std_logic = 1 / 0 ja std_logic_vector on n std_logic-ut, nt std_logic = ’1’ ja std_logic_vector =
„1010“
46. Mitme bitine on vaikimisi VHDL keeles integer?
32bitti
47. Mis on SIGNED ja UNSIGNED ning mis erinevus on nende muutujate väärtuses?
Signed on märgiga arv ja unsigned märgita arv, signed puhul näitab esimene bitt märki, 1 on –
ja 0 on +.
48. Mida tähendab VHDLi kood: x <= a & b;?
a-le lisatakse järgi b ja selle tehte tulemus omistatakse X-ile.
49. Nimeta kaks moodust VHDLis konverteerimise kasutamiseks?
to_signed(S), signed(S);
50. Missugused operaatorid (tehtemärgid) on VHDLis kasutatavad? Nimetage vähemalt 5
And, or, not, +, -
51. Olgu meil: SIGNAL d : STD_LOGIC_VECTOR (7 DOWNTO 0); Mis väärtused on:
d'LOW, d'HIGH, d'LEFT, d'RIGHT, d'LENGTH, d'RANGE=( ), d'REVERSE_RANGE=( )?
d’LOW – tagastab madalaima massiivi indeksi
d’HIGH – tagastab kõrgeima massiivi indeksi
d’LEFT – tagastab vasakpoolseima massiivi indeksi